Facts about Fred The Fish

Who wrote Fred The Fish lyrics?


Fred The Fish is written by daevid allen.

When was Fred The Fish released?


Fred The Fish is first released in 1971 as part of Daevid Allen's album "Banana Moon" which includes 8 tracks in total.

Which genre is Fred The Fish?


Fred The Fish falls under the genre Rock.
